Macron acknowledges the social response to pension reform, but defends dialogue

Macron moved to the alpine town of Savines le Lac, where he visited a marsh that reflects the effects of the drought. SEBASTIEN NOGIERPOOL | EFE

The French president is trying to turn the page by presenting a plan to combat the drought

This Thursday, Emmanuel Macron tried to turn the page on the pension reform by presenting the program 50 measures to combat drought during a visit to the marshes in Savines le Lac, in the French Alps. But in his first exit from the Elysée in two months, the president had to obey cries of “resignation” started by two hundred people.

Tension was evident during the visit, with some police efforts to clear the route the presidential motorcade had to take and the arrest of two protesters. Macron was open. “There are 200 protesters, but This does not mean that the Republic has to stop »he assured a group of journalists, pointing out that the pension reform must not paralyze the other challenges the country is facing.

Macron admitted it “There is a social response” to his plan to raise the retirement age to 64, but defended dialogue as a way to resolve current differences, pending an appointment between the Government and the unions next week. The latter count on the continuation of strikes and demonstrations, and the next ones are scheduled for April 6.

He added that the opponents of his reform have democratic channels for its abolition, the same ones, as he said, that he used to push it through parliamentary procedures. In front of them, he condemned the violent acts that marred the protests and accused some political leaders to legitimize them, seeking to distinguish radicals from others.

As an example, he cited the protests last Saturday in holy salt against an artificial reservoir for agricultural irrigation that led to a fierce battle with the police, which left two protesters in a coma. “There were thousands of people who just went to war,” he showed.
